Arround the Szczecin Lagoon (POL 02)

Villa Oppenheim Heringsdorf

1. day: Heringsdorf/Isle Usedom

Independent arrival at the starting hotel in Heringsdorf. Overnight stay.

Strand von Mistroj

2. day: Ahlbeck - Mistroy/Dziwnówek, approximately 40/65 km

Cycling tour to the border. Meeting with the baggage driver. There will be taken care of your baggage when it is taken across the border and is transported to the next hotel. You cycle through Wollin, across the Wollin national park to the coastal resort Mistroy.

Slawen und Wikinger

3. day: Mistroy - Wollin/Piaski, approximately 30/50 km

Via the city of Kamien Pomorski with its impressive cathedral the tour continues inland to Wollin. 1000 years ago Wollin was a very famous settlement of the Slavs and many people say that there is a connection with the legendary Vineta.

Naturpark Stettiner Haff

4. day: Wollin/Piaski - Szczecin, approximately 75 km

By taking the eastern side of the Lagoon of Szczecin you are able to cycle to Stepenitz. You are surrounded by nature around the little holiday village near to the lagoon. You continue your journey through the heathland of Gollnow until you are in Szczecin. Partly on back roads or forest paths you arrive in Szczecin. Accommodation in the centre of the city.

Stettiner Schloß

5. day: Szczecin - Ückermünde, approximately 65 km

The large city of Szczecin is a seaside town in the interior. The historic centre, destroyed during World War II, has gradually been rebuilt. You will get a transfer for the bikes and the baggage to the border crossing at Linken. Beyond the border you will cycle on the lagoon path to Ückermünde.

Hafen Ueckermünde

6. day: Ückermünde - Anklam/Bömitz, approximately 50 km

Before continuing your travel you can visit the very interesting Museum of the the Lagoon and the castle. If the weather is warm, the beach of Mönkebude will be a good place to stop. The reeds by the waterside will guide you to Anklam. Overnight stay in Anklam or Bömitz.

Panorama Anklam

7. day: Anklam/Bömitz - Heringsdorf, approximately 50 km

Crossing the bridge at Anklam you arrive at the Isle of Usedom. In the east you can see the steeple of the little village of Usedom. The ancient railway bridge of Karnin is a technical monument at the Strom. It was the connection between the railway line Berlin - Swinemünde. Also in Garz you can make an interesting little tour to the lagoon of Kaminke. From the hills the lagoon extends through the country like a small sea in a southerly direction.

Strand in Sicht

8. day: Heringsdorf

After breakfast you hand over the bikes to the tour organizer and return home independently. If you want to stay, we shall be happy to book an extra night in one of the seaside resorts of Heringsdorf, Ahlbeck or Bansin for you.
